Psalm 119: 57-64

1/15/2014

0 Comments

 
Scripture:
The LORD is my portion; 
      I promise to keep your words. 
 I entreat your favor with all my heart; 
      be gracious to me according to your promise. 
When I think on my ways, 
      I turn my feet to your testimonies; 
I hasten and do not delay 
      to keep your commandments. 
Though the cords of the wicked ensnare me, 
      I do not forget your law. 
At midnight I rise to praise you, 
      because of your righteous rules. 
I am a companion of all who fear you, 
      of those who keep your precepts. 
The earth, O LORD, is full of your steadfast love; 
      teach me your statutes!  -Psalm 119:57-64, ESV

Observation:
-God's rules are righteous; His love is steadfast; He is to be feared.
-The one who loves/fears the L ord will keep His commandments/follwo in His ways
-We share fellowship with fellow believers.

Application:
I sense in these verses a fervent desire to follow God.  This is not a person who would be content simply sitting in a pew on the Lord's day, occasionally picking up a Bible to read, and handing out a tract to people met during the day.  This is someone who wants to be "fully alive" for the Lord, to borrow a phrase from Christian comedian Ken Davis. (Not the Ken Davis that I am married to.)  We watched Fully Alive on Netflix instant play last night so I suppose I am being influenced this morning as I think over these verses.

Let's take a closer look at the actions of this individual in these few verses.
-a keeper of God's word
-entreats God's favor with all his heart
-thinks about God's ways
-turns his feet to follow the Lord
-hastens to keep God's commands
-At midnight! he rises to praise the Lord
-is eager to learn from God

This is someone who has put his whole heart, soul, and mind into loving the Lord.  And why does he choose to live this way.  Because he has come to know God through His word, through His promises, through His statutes.  That knowledge of who God is has caused him to respond with his whole life.   I need to have that same attitude.  I need to spend my days getting to know the God I serve-for in that process my love for Him will grow, my desire to obey will increase, my whole being will improve as I set my mind in Christ.
